Which type of books does Bacon suggest should be "chewed and digested"?

AThose that require close attention

BThose that are lengthy

CThose that are philosophical

DThose that are entertaining

Answer:

A. Those that require close attention

Read Explanation:

  • Bacon writes that there can be many types of books.

  • Some books are only tasted or read superficially while others are swallowed means demands more seriousness.

  • But some other books deserve to be chewed and digested means reading thoroughly and deeply.

  • Some books can be studied by subordinate or junior people who make notes of them and which are read by others.

  • But such books are unimportant for serious affairs. As such books can be compared to distilled water which is devoid of all the nutrients.
